I went yesterday (Saturday) and wandered around for a bit. It was packed when I first got there, I often had to pause and let people walk by as the aisles were stuffed. A lot of cool animals, and a good amount of ball pythons. Pickings were slim for what I was particularly searching for (ivory, gstripe, pied), but I almost picked up a female genetic stripe for a really good price. Alas, its stripe was not perfect with several breaks, and I ultimately passed. If you're in the market for a co-dom ball, you're gonna get it for a really good price!
I wanted a snapping turtle, but apparently they can't sell them in CA? And yet, hatchling turtles well under the 4 inch rule were being sold... I wanted to buy a hatchling Eastern snake-necked turtle and had decided to make my rounds first, but when I came back it had sold. Oh well, ya snooze ya lose.
My highlight was the indigos! My first time seeing those in person and they are very impressive. I might have to pick one of those up in the future. Good show overall!
